| What Is New in World Clock |
Version 1.1.1
The graphical user interface of the application is updated to reflect the changes in OS 7 and the new high resolution devices (Bold 9900 / 9930, Torch 9810, Torch 9850 / 9860, etc.).
Version 1.1
New Features
The idea behind this new feature is to help the user see / check the time at her desired locations easily and quickly without having to open the entire World Clock application. Screen saver works pretty much like a regular PC / Desktop screen saver. It is displayed on top of user's screen and is activated after a predefined inactivity time which can be configured. It displays all the clocks (locations) the user added to her main screen in World Clock and actually looks pretty much like the main screen of World Clock. By default screen saver is turned off.
In version 1.0 there was a limit of up to six clocks which the user can add to the main screen of World Clock. This limit is now removed so the user can add as much clocks as needed.
In version 1.0 the time format used by the application was automatically detected from user's device settings. In 1.1 we also added an explicit setting in World Clock to choose the time format. It has three options: a) automatically detect from device (as in 1.0); b) always AM / PM format; c) always 24h format.
